Eligibility criteria
Applicants, who have appeared in CAT/JEMAT can apply for our MBA Programme. Minimum qualification for admission to MBA programme is Bachelor’s Degree in any discipline with 50% marks, recognized by the Association of Indian Universities.
Candidates, who would be completing all requirements for bachelor’s degree by 30 June, can also apply.
Such candidates, if selected, will be admitted provisionally and will be required to produce evidence to establish their eligibility by 31 August. Those, failing to comply with the above criteria, will have to withdraw from the programme.
AIMK Eligibility Criteria
Candidates, who appeared in CAT would be called for Group Discussion & Personal Interview (GD & PI ). Two separate (one for Army and another for General) merit lists of the candidates will be prepared for GD & PI. The same is to be sent to the Chairman for approval. After approval, students of the merit list will be intimated individually.
Those candidate, who have valid JEMAT Rank card and Allotment card from MAKAUT, would be directly admitted to our Institute.
Eligibility for Army Category
The admission to the AWES Professional Colleges is for the children of eligible serving Army personnel, eligible ex-Army personnel and war widows of the Army. The children of following categories of Army personnel are eligible and they are required to submit the relevant certificate as given against the category applicable to them as proof of their eligibility for admission to AWES Professional Colleges along with the Application Form :-
The applicants must follow into one of the following categories:-
(a) Children of Serving Army Personnel, Retired/Released/Discharged/Killed in action/Died During Service/Disabled in Action/Medically Boarded out with Pension (Submit Certificate No 1):-
(i) Children of serving Army personnel with minimum 10 years continuous service in the Army
(ii) Children of ex Army personnel granted/ awarded regular pension, liberalized family pension, family pension or disability pension at the time of their superannuation, demise, discharge, release medical board/ invalided medical board. This includes wards of recruits medically boarded out and granted disability pension.
(iii) Children of ex Army personnel who have taken discharge or released after ten years of service.
(b) Adopted/Step Children and Children of Remarried Widows (Submit Certificate No 2):-
(i) Adopted Children of Army personnel if adopted at least five years prior to seeking admission.
(ii) Step Children are eligible provided they are born from a wedding where at least one parent belonged to the Army who is otherwise eligible.
(c) Eligibility Criteria in Special Cases (Submit Certificate No 3):-
(i) Eligibility Criteria for Children of Ex Army Medical Corps Officers/Army Dental Corps Officers Presently Serving with Indian Navy or Indian Air Force (IN/IAF). Children of only those ex-Army Medical officers/Army Dental Corps officers presently serving with Indian Navy/Indian Air Force who have served with the Army for at least 10 years.
(ii) Eligibility Criteria for Children of APS/MNS/TA Personnel:-
(aa) Children of APS personnel classified as ex-servicemen as per Government of India, Ministry of Defence letter No 9 (52)/88/D(Res) dated 19 Jul 89.
(ab) Children of those APS personnel who are on deputation and who have put in 10 years of service in the Army.
(ac) Children of APS personnel, who are directly recruited into APS who have completed 10 years of service and of those who as per their terms and conditions of service, retired from APS without reversion to P&T Department after completing their minimum pensionable service of which 10 years was in the Army.
(ad) Children of only those members of MNS who have 10 years service as regular members of MNS or are in receipt of pension from the Army.
(ae) Children of only those TA personnel who have completed 10 years of embodied service

Refund Policy in Case of Withdrawal
In the event of a student/candidate withdrawing before the starting of the course, the entire fee collected from the student, after a deduction of the processing fee of not more than Rs 1000/- (Rupees One Thousand only) shall be refunded/ returned by the institution. If a student leaves after joining the course and if the vacated seat is consequently filled up by another student by the last date of admission, the institution will refund the fee collected after a deduction of the processing fee of not more than Rs 1000/- (Rupees One Thousand only) and proportionate deductions of monthly fee and proportionate hostel rent, where applicable. In case the vacated seat is not filled, the institution will refund the security deposit and return the original documents.
